Output 25c52f85e396fa19d2a4bcc99bfd35622be553c18820b0cb2c83f02bf4e56614:1

value
17219527
script pubkey
OP_0 OP_PUSHBYTES_20 0d274d8487f7f3e58a3c8181e6b483c3d9e1aae1
address
bc1qp5n5mpy87le7tz3usxq7ddyrc0v7r2hpdfvaza
transaction
25c52f85e396fa19d2a4bcc99bfd35622be553c18820b0cb2c83f02bf4e56614
spent
true